and another fix
This commit is contained in:
parent
0f395c1b11
commit
91e569ca37
2 changed files with 4 additions and 3 deletions
4
client.c
4
client.c
|
@ -209,8 +209,6 @@ manage(Window w, XWindowAttributes *wa) {
|
||||||
c->h = wa->height;
|
c->h = wa->height;
|
||||||
c->th = bh;
|
c->th = bh;
|
||||||
updatesize(c);
|
updatesize(c);
|
||||||
c->isfixed = (c->maxw && c->minw && c->maxh && c->minh &&
|
|
||||||
c->maxw == c->minw && c->maxh == c->minh);
|
|
||||||
if(c->x + c->w + 2 * BORDERPX > sw)
|
if(c->x + c->w + 2 * BORDERPX > sw)
|
||||||
c->x = sw - c->w - 2 * BORDERPX;
|
c->x = sw - c->w - 2 * BORDERPX;
|
||||||
if(c->x < sx)
|
if(c->x < sx)
|
||||||
|
@ -341,6 +339,8 @@ updatesize(Client *c) {
|
||||||
}
|
}
|
||||||
else
|
else
|
||||||
c->minw = c->minh = 0;
|
c->minw = c->minh = 0;
|
||||||
|
c->isfixed = (c->maxw && c->minw && c->maxh && c->minh &&
|
||||||
|
c->maxw == c->minw && c->maxh == c->minh);
|
||||||
if(c->flags & PWinGravity)
|
if(c->flags & PWinGravity)
|
||||||
c->grav = size.win_gravity;
|
c->grav = size.win_gravity;
|
||||||
else
|
else
|
||||||
|
|
3
event.c
3
event.c
|
@ -136,7 +136,8 @@ buttonpress(XEvent *e) {
|
||||||
}
|
}
|
||||||
else if(ev->button == Button2)
|
else if(ev->button == Button2)
|
||||||
zoom(NULL);
|
zoom(NULL);
|
||||||
else if(ev->button == Button3 && (arrange == dofloat || c->isfloat) && !c->isfixed) {
|
else if(ev->button == Button3 && (arrange == dofloat || c->isfloat) &&
|
||||||
|
!c->isfixed) {
|
||||||
restack();
|
restack();
|
||||||
resizemouse(c);
|
resizemouse(c);
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in a new issue